Eagers Automotive Surges on Revenue Growth Outlook -- Market Talk

Dow Jones
27 Feb

0035 GMT - Eagers Automotive's annual result and outlook send its shares up 22% to erase all of the losses over the past 12 months. According to Jefferies, Eagers delivered a solid result in challenging times for the auto dealer sector. Still, underlying net profit of A$221 million was a 4% miss to Jefferies's forecasts. Eagers expects FY 2025 revenue to grow by another A$1 billion and that pleases analyst John Campbell assuming it's achieved from existing assets. "Eagers is still exposed to weakening new vehicle sales in FY 2025 but nonetheless, FY 2025 revenue guidance speaks to a high level of confidence," Jefferies says.
